**Q: How do we run schema migrations on Harrowdale without downtime?**

All migrations follow the expand-migrate-contract pattern: add the new column, dual-write from the application, backfill in batches, then drop the old column only after two release cycles. Destructive changes require a migration review ticket. The checklist and backfill tooling instructions are documented on the internal page below.

runbook for badug-kadup: https://confluence.zemvarlabs.internal/projects/browse/display/projects/bd1b

TICKET: Sealed vault blocking FX rounding fix

The Corvex finance vault locked itself after three failed unseal attempts while we were patching the half-cent rounding drift in the Pellem currency converter. The rounding bug truncates rather than banker-rounds on ISK and JPY pairs, so do not ship until the vault reopens and the rate tables are verified. To unseal, open the Corvex console and supply the recovery passphrase that follows.

strongbox words: fenwyn-lamix-novael-holeth-sorix-druael-lamwyn

Subject: Brightmoor Term Sheet — Summary

Team,

Brightmoor Holdings returned their revised term sheet yesterday. Key points: a three-year exclusivity window for the Vexel product line, a 12% revenue share, and quarterly true-ups handled by our finance group. Their counsel dropped the earlier indemnity cap demand. Finance should model both the base and downside cases before Friday's call with Dorrin Hale. Context on how this fits our broader direction follows below.

board note of kageg-bahof: The renewal with Holwynax Holdings closes at $2 million a year, 5 percent below the last contract. Project Ulaath slips by two quarters because of the supplier delay.

Onboarding bite for on-call: retrying failed exports in Parcelworks. Most export failures are transient — the warehouse feed times out, the job lands in the dead-letter list. Just requeue it from the exports dashboard; it's idempotent, so double-runs are safe. If the same job fails three times, follow the escalation steps on the page below.

operations page: https://jenkins.zemvarcloud.local/job/merge_requests/repo/build/73930b4b30f0a8ed